More than 1,000 new cases of Mpox were reported in Congo last week, health officials say.

The World Health Organization (WHO) has declared a global public health emergency over the outbreak, with more than 18,000 cases and 500 deaths reported worldwide.

African officials say vaccines are desperately needed to fight back the outbreak.

Mpox, previously known as monkeypox, is spread by close skin-to-skin contact including sexual intercourse. The current Mpox strain is much more transmissible than previous strains from a 2022 outbreak.
